How to Create A HTML Food Table In Dreamweaver With A Colored Border
You can get started right away with Adobe Dreamweaver when it comes to creating or inserting new tables into a webpage. Quickly click “Insert” from the top main menu, then select “Table”. Its not difficult. See what I mean on the image below.
After selecting insert and table, there will be the opportunity to enter the amount of rows and columns you wish to have. In addtition to the number of columns and rows, enter table properties such as table width, border thickness, cell spacing, alignment, and even a description.
Table Border Colors
The top ten food list example shows a red background (Bg color) color in the first coloumn and a red border (Brdr color). Check the image below to locate where to modify the colors.
